About David Gonçalves
David Gonçalves is a scholar working on Archeology, Paleontology, Insect Science, Anthropology and Radiation, having authored 72 papers that have together received 1.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Forensic Anthropology and Bioarchaeology Studies (55 papers), Paleopathology and ancient diseases (38 papers), Forensic Entomology and Diptera Studies (19 papers), Forensic and Genetic Research (12 papers), Archaeology and ancient environmental studies (12 papers), Pleistocene-Era Hominins and Archaeology (9 papers), Nuclear Physics and Applications (7 papers) and Autopsy Techniques and Outcomes (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Archeology (982 citations), Paleontology (286 citations), Anthropology (157 citations), Insect Science (176 citations) and Radiation (84 citations). David Gonçalves has collaborated with scholars based in Portugal, United Kingdom and Italy. Frequent co-authors include Eugénia Cunha, Tim Thompson, Luís A. E. Batista de Carvalho, M. Paula M. Marques, A. P. Mamede, María Teresa Ferreira, David Navega, Francisco Curate, Stewart F. Parker and Giampaolo Piga. Their work appears in journals such as Science & Justice, International Journal of Legal Medicine, Forensic Science International, Archaeological and Anthropological Sciences and American Journal of Physical Anthropology.
